Output 3999537c35404df05686e1a8ace9834915d268f45098e97d53dfd186889d9428:4

value
225627
script pubkey
OP_0 OP_PUSHBYTES_20 7407dd2361bbed6c1edec779fb83e32395892546
address
bc1qwsra6gmph0kkc8k7caulhqlryw2cjf2xenvl2n
transaction
3999537c35404df05686e1a8ace9834915d268f45098e97d53dfd186889d9428
confirmations
159661
spent
true